My prayer for lost souls today


Lord, I lift up lost souls everywhere to You right now. I especially lift up the most rebellious, most militant ones who are running from You the hardest.

I pray Lord You will roll away the stones of unbelief from their hearts. I pray You will arrest them in the Spirit and hold them in place, do whatever it takes to get their full attention on You so You can save them.

Thank You for showing them their sin from Your perspective and showing them the goodness and mercy and beauty of Jesus.

In Jesus’ Matchless Name I pray,

Amen.

Be Very Vigilant


My children, the time of your homecoming quickly approaches. I desire you would prepare yourselves that you would be ready to leave your earthly abodes.


My desire is you would each examine yourselves very closely. Look for even the slightest traces of sin. Search your hearts for unforgiveness. Search your hearts for Offense. Search your hearts for lust and for idolatry. Is there any greed? Any falsehoods you have not repented of? Is there even the slightest trace of pridefulness?


I desire you would lay down every sin you find within yourselves that you may be ready to come home when I call for you. Be very vigilant now, My children, for the enemy of your souls roams about seeking whom he may devour.


1 Peter 5:4 KJV


And when the chief Shepherd shall appear, ye shall receive a crown of glory that fadeth not away.


1 Peter 5:5 KJV


Likewise, ye younger, submit yourselves unto the elder. Yea, all of you be subject one to another, and be clothed with humility: for God resisteth the proud, and giveth grace to the humble.


1 Peter 5:6 KJV


Humble yourselves therefore under the mighty hand of God, that he may exalt you in due time:


1 Peter 5:7 KJV


Casting all your care upon him; for he careth for you.


1 Peter 5:8 KJV


Be sober, be vigilant; because your adversary the devil, as a roaring lion, walketh about, seeking whom he may devour:


1 Peter 5:9 KJV


Whom resist stedfast in the faith, knowing that the same afflictions are accomplished in your brethren that are in the world.


1 Peter 5:10 KJV


But the God of all grace, who hath called us unto his eternal glory by Christ Jesus, after that ye have suffered a while, make you perfect, stablish, strengthen, settle you.


1 Peter 5:11 KJV


To him be glory and dominion for ever and ever. Amen.

You Will See the Cross

Things shall begin going in unexpected directions in many of your lives. Trust Me.

Trust Me.

I know where we are going and I know how to get you there, but I must have your unfailing trust in these matters.

At times, you will think you have been derailed from your purpose, or that you have missed My will. This is especially true in the lives of My children when things do not go according to their imaginations of the proper order or My intents and purposes, but I say to you now, My children, that you do not always know or correctly discern My intents and purposes. For My thoughts are higher than your thoughts, and My ways and intents will always be for the greater good of My overall Kingdom, whereas you tend to focus more on one or two lives, or for your own pleasures.

In these end times, I require effective warriors, those who have truly been tried by fire, purified for My higher use. Those who have walked the valleys of hardship and remained strong in the face of all they encountered, those who will speak boldly for My cause, not cower in fear before public opinion.

Will you be My warrior? Can you qualify? Or do you look down on others who live differently than you? Those whose choices led them a different path, yet still I choose to use? Are they your brothers, too?

I judge the hearts and reins, but many of My children still judge by what they see. Look more deeply, My children.

Look for Me in what you see.

You will see the Cross in what is of Me.

Proverbs 3:5-7: Trust in the Lord with all thine heart; and lean not unto thine own understanding. 6 In all thy ways acknowledge him, and he shall direct thy paths. 7 Be not wise in thine own eyes: fear the Lord, and depart from evil.

Isaiah 55:9: For as the heavens are higher than the earth, so are my ways higher than your ways, and my thoughts than your thoughts.

Zechariah 13:9: And I will bring the third part through the fire, and will refine them as silver is refined, and will try them as gold is tried: they shall call on my name, and I will hear them: I will say, It is my people: and they shall say, The LORD is my God.

1 Peter 1:7: That the trial of your faith, being much more precious than of gold that perisheth, though it be tried with fire, might be found unto praise and honour and glory at the appearing of Jesus Christ:

Ephesians 6:19-20: And for me, that utterance may be given unto me, that I may open my mouth boldly, to make known the mystery of the gospel, 20 For which I am an ambassador in bonds: that therein I may speak boldly, as I ought to speak.

James 2:1-5:

1 My brethren, have not the faith of our Lord Jesus Christ, the Lord of glory, with respect of persons.

2 For if there come unto your assembly a man with a gold ring, in goodly apparel, and there come in also a poor man in vile raiment;

3 And ye have respect to him that weareth the gay clothing, and say unto him, Sit thou here in a good place; and say to the poor, Stand thou there, or sit here under my footstool:

4 Are ye not then partial in yourselves, and are become judges of evil thoughts?

5 Hearken, my beloved brethren, Hath not God chosen the poor of this world rich in faith, and heirs of the kingdom which he hath promised to them that love him?

Jeremiah 17:10: I the LORD search the heart, I try the reins, even to give every man according to his ways, and according to the fruit of his doings.
